    Magnavox 32" LCD TV Troubleshooting

    Hey.

    I am trying to repair a Magnavox 32" LCD TV. When I turn it on the backlights flash on for about a tenth of a second. I opened up the panel and checked the backlights. One was broken and I replaced it. However, nothing changed and I believe I may have broken the backlight while trying to open the lcd. I have checked the inverter board for power and the ON signal. It has both, as well as 5v at the inverter ic VCC pin. All of the transformers seem to check out fine, 2 bars on a flyback tester. However, one transformer has a slightly higher resistance (1.78k instead of 1.35k) in one secondary winding. Any suggestions as to what to do next?

    Thanks.

    Ps. I get an interesting result if I unplug one set of backlights from the board and then turn on the tv. The backlights stay on for about 1 sec instead of a tenth.
